Crushed Campbell's Soup Can: Beef Noodle
Andy Warhol's Crushed Campbell's Soup Can: Beef Noodle is a seminal work from the artist's iconic series that transformed everyday consumer goods into high art. Created in 1962, this piece reflects Warhol's fascination with mass production and the American consumer landscape. The image of the crushed can, with its distorted label and dented metal, challenges notions of perfection and permanence, offering a commentary on the fragility of the objects we take for granted.
